What is a missionary fare? How do I get one?
To obtain a “Missionary/Humanitarian” fare, you must be able to show that you are travelling under the auspices of a non-profit (501-c3) organization. You may be asked for show proof of this fact, so we recommend you carry identification that shows you on a “Humanitarian” mission, as some countries can take offense to the term “Missionary.” Most airlines offering these exclusive fares do not require immediate payment, giving you and your team extra time for fund raising.
You will not find humanitarian fares on the internet from sites like Expedia or Kayak. Humanitarian fares are private contracts with the airlines and are often available for hundreds of dollars less than what you will find elsewhere.
